64 #ifdef PIC
65 /*
66  * PIC_PROLOGUE() is akin to the compiler generated function prologue for
67  * PIC code. It leaves the address of the Global Offset Table in DEST,
68  * clobbering register TMP in the process.
69  *
70  * We can use two code sequences.  We can read the %pc or use the call
71  * instruction that saves the pc in %o7.  Call requires the branch unit and
72  * IEU1, and clobbers %o7 which needs to be restored.  This instruction
73  * sequence takes about 4 cycles due to instruction interdependence.  Reading
74  * the pc takes 4 cycles to dispatch and is always dispatched alone.  That
75  * sequence takes 7 cycles.
76  */
77 #ifdef __arch64__
78 #define PIC_PROLOGUE(dest,tmp) \
79 	mov %o7, tmp; \
80 	sethi %hi(_GLOBAL_OFFSET_TABLE_-4),dest; \
81 	call 0f; \
82 	 or dest,%lo(_GLOBAL_OFFSET_TABLE_+4),dest; \
83 0: \
84 	add dest,%o7,dest; \
85 	mov tmp, %o7
86 #else
87 #define PIC_PROLOGUE(dest,tmp) \
88 	mov %o7,tmp; 3: call 4f; nop; 4: \
89 	sethi %hi(_C_LABEL(_GLOBAL_OFFSET_TABLE_)-(3b-.)),dest; \
90 	or dest,%lo(_C_LABEL(_GLOBAL_OFFSET_TABLE_)-(3b-.)),dest; \
91 	add dest,%o7,dest; mov tmp,%o7
92 #endif
93 
94 /*
95  * PICCY_SET() does the equivalent of a `set var, %dest' instruction in
96  * a PIC-like way, but without involving the Global Offset Table. This
97  * only works for VARs defined in the same file *and* in the text segment.
98  */
99 #ifdef __arch64__
100 #define PICCY_SET(var,dest,tmp) \
101 	3: rd %pc, tmp; add tmp,(var-3b),dest
102 #else
103 #define PICCY_SET(var,dest,tmp) \
104 	mov %o7,tmp; 3: call 4f; nop; 4: \
105 	add %o7,(var-3b),dest; mov tmp,%o7
106 #endif
107 #else
108 #define PIC_PROLOGUE(dest,tmp)
109 #define PICCY_OFFSET(var,dest,tmp)
110 #endif

176 /*
177  * STRONG_ALIAS: create a strong alias.
178  */
179 #define STRONG_ALIAS(alias,sym)						\
180 	.globl alias;							\
181 	alias = sym
182 
183 /*
184  * WARN_REFERENCES: create a warning if the specified symbol is referenced.
185  */
186 #ifdef __ELF__
187 #ifdef __STDC__
188 #define	WARN_REFERENCES(sym,msg)					\
189 	.pushsection .gnu.warning. ## sym;				\
190 	.ascii msg;							\
191 	.popsection
192 #else
193 #define	WARN_REFERENCES(sym,msg)					\
194 	.pushsection .gnu.warning./**/sym;				\
195 	.ascii msg;							\
196 	.popsection
197 #endif /* __STDC__ */
198 #else
199 #ifdef __STDC__
200 #define	__STRING(x)			#x
201 #define	WARN_REFERENCES(sym,msg)					\
202 	.stabs msg ## ,30,0,0,0 ;					\
203 	.stabs __STRING(_ ## sym) ## ,1,0,0,0
204 #else
205 #define	__STRING(x)			"x"
206 #define	WARN_REFERENCES(sym,msg)					\
207 	.stabs msg,30,0,0,0 ;						\
208 	.stabs __STRING(_/**/sym),1,0,0,0
209 #endif /* __STDC__ */
210 #endif /* __ELF__ */
